Incorporating CPM Throughout Different Platforms
Present Advertising: Present advertising is just one of the most typical uses CPM. By positioning banner ads on websites and apps, you can get to customers across the web and build brand name understanding. CPM allows you to spend for impacts instead of clicks, making it suitable for projects that concentrate on visibility and reach.

Social Media Site: Social media site systems, such as Facebook, Instagram, and Twitter, provide CPM-based advertising and marketing choices. By utilizing CPM on social media sites, you can target particular demographics, rate of interests, and habits, ensuring that your advertisements are revealed to individuals that are more likely to involve with your brand name.

Video Advertising and marketing: Video advertisements on systems like YouTube and TikTok can also be bought on a CPM basis. Video clip ads are extremely interesting and can efficiently catch the target market's attention. CPM allows you to pay for every 1,000 views of your video, making it a reliable means to reach a large audience and drive brand name recognition.

Mobile Advertising and marketing: Mobile advertising includes advertisements showed on mobile applications and websites. CPM is typically used in mobile marketing to reach individuals on their mobile phones and tablets. By enhancing your CPM campaigns for mobile, you can guarantee that your advertisements show up to individuals across different devices.

Programmatic Advertising and marketing: Programmatic advertising and marketing entails utilizing automated systems to buy and sell ad room in real-time. CPM is a vital prices version in programmatic marketing, allowing you to bid for impressions and get to particular audience segments with accuracy.

Maximizing CPM Campaigns in a Multi-Channel Approach
Keep Constant Branding: Constant branding across all networks is vital for creating a cohesive individual experience. Make sure that your ad creatives, messaging, and visual aspects are aligned across various platforms. This uniformity helps enhance your brand identity and enhances the effectiveness of your CPM projects.

Sector and Target Your Audience: Use innovative targeting options to sector your audience based on demographics, rate of interests, and actions. By targeting specific audience sectors, you can ensure that your ads are shown to individuals that are more probable to be interested in your brand. This targeted technique improves the performance of your CPM campaigns and boosts the chance of achieving your advertising goals.

Screen Performance Across Channels: Regularly monitor the performance of your CPM campaigns across different networks. Usage analytics tools to track essential metrics such as impressions, reach, and engagement. Assessing performance information enables you to recognize which networks are providing the best results and make data-driven choices to enhance your campaigns.

Readjust Quotes and Budgets: Based on the efficiency of your CPM campaigns, readjust your quotes and budgets to optimize your reach and expense effectiveness. Assign extra resources to channels that are doing well and enhance your bids to make sure that you are obtaining the very best value for your advertisement spend.

Experiment with Advertisement Styles: Various ad styles can yield varying outcomes. Experiment with different advertisement formats, such as display screen banners, video ads, and interactive layouts, to determine which styles reverberate finest with your target market. Evaluating and maximizing advertisement formats can help enhance the performance of your CPM projects.

Utilize Retargeting Methods: Retargeting entails showing ads to individuals that have actually formerly connected with your brand name. By incorporating retargeting into your CPM strategy, you can increase ad significance and drive greater engagement rates. Retargeting helps keep your brand name top-of-mind and urges customers to do something about it.
